Exclusive: Wakefield Trinity have targeted the signing of Hull FC centre Josh Griffin.

rugbyleaguehub.com Long Reads understands Wakefield are keen to add Griffin to their roster, potentially for this season, if not for 2024.

Trinity are in a fierce battle to avoid relegation.

Griffin is off-contract at the end of this season.

It is believed Black & Whites are open to letting the veteran outside back leave the club.

The centre is 33 and actually started his career back at Wakefield in 2008.

Griffin has scored 95 tries from 221 appearances during his time in Super League.

He has had stints at Huddersfield, Castleford, Batley and Salford.

Griffin joined Hull FC in 2017 and has made over 100 appearances for the club.

He helped the Black & Whites win the Challenge Cup in his first season in east Yorkshire.

The older brother of Tigers prop George, Josh was handed a seven-game ban in June after being sent off in a Challenge Cup tie against St Helens.
